Deposit Limits: The One Tool You Are Not Using

I mentioned this earlier, but it deserves its own section. Every single reputable casino offers deposit limits. You can set a daily, weekly, or monthly limit. Why is this important? Because it stops you from chasing losses.

Here is a scenario. You lose $200 in ten minutes. Your adrenaline is up. You want to deposit another $200 to win it back. If you have a daily deposit limit of $200, you cannot. The system blocks you. That is a feature, not a bug.

For the best payid deposit pokies australia 2026 instant play sites, I recommend setting a weekly limit of $500 or $1000, depending on your budget. Do not set a limit you cannot afford. And do not set it so high that it is meaningless. A $10,000 weekly limit is not a limit. It is a suggestion.

Also, check if the casino allows you to change the limit immediately. Some sites make you wait 24 hours before a limit increase takes effect. That is good. It gives you a cooling-off period. If a site lets you increase your limit instantly, that is a red flag.

How to Choose a Pokie That Pays Fairly

Not all pokies are created equal. Some have a Return to Player (RTP) of 94%, which is low. Others have 97% or higher. You want the higher number. It means you get back $97 for every $100 you wager, on average. Over the long term, that matters.

Here is a quick list of pokies with high RTP that work well on mobile:

  • Blood Suckers (98% RTP) – Classic, simple, and runs smoothly on any browser.
  • Starburst (96.1% RTP) – Overrated but reliable. Works on touchscreens perfectly.
  • Mega Joker (99% RTP) – If you can find it, play it. The RTP is insane.
  • Jackpot 6000 (98.9% RTP) – Another NetEnt classic. Very low volatility.

Avoid progressive jackpot pokies if you are on a budget. They usually have a lower base RTP (around 88-92%) because the jackpot takes a cut. You are better off with fixed jackpot games.
